Why did the Marshall Plan include aid for the defeated Axis powers?

Answer:

One of the purposes of the Marshall Plan was to aid nations in economic recovery from WWII.

Explanation:

The Marshall Plan aided the defeated Axis powers because that's one of the reasons it was created, The Marshall Plan was supposed to rehabilitate the economies of the 17 western and southern European countries in order to create stable conditions for democracy to continue.
